This runbook covers Squintcheck, our typo-squatting package scanner. It polls the Marlburn registry mirror every ten minutes, compares new package names against a Levenshtein table of our internal libraries, and flags anything within edit distance two. If a flag fires, don't panic — most are false positives from hobby projects. Triage them in the Squintcheck dashboard and escalate genuine squats to the registry team. To pull scan results programmatically or replay a flagged batch, call the Squintcheck API with the key below.

gateway credential: kto3_qfe

// Client setup for the Harwick Deck occupancy feed.
// Polls the Stallgrid aggregator every 30 seconds and pushes
// per-level counts into the signage cache. Counts are eventually
// consistent; do not treat a zero as "garage closed." Timeouts
// are intentionally short so stale reads fall back to the last
// good snapshot. Authenticate against the Stallgrid internal API
// with the key that follows.

gateway credential: zpat4_qSKI

Subject: Cold starts on Fernwheel handlers

Welcome to the rotation. Quick heads-up: the Fernwheel serverless handlers cold-start slowly after deploys, so latency alerts in the first ten minutes are usually noise. Don't roll back for p99 spikes alone — check invocation age first. Pre-warming runs every five minutes but can lag after config pushes. If cold starts persist past fifteen minutes, escalate. The warmup dashboard and tuning notes live here.

runbook for badug-kadup: https://confluence.zemvarlabs.internal/projects/browse/display/projects/bd1b

Quarterly Planning Note — Board

Quick update on the Brindlewood licensing mess. Tessara Media still claims our Fernhollow app uses their mapping layer outside the agreed scope. Counsel thinks their read of clause coverage is shaky, but arbitration in Port Averline could drag into next year. We've paused the planned Fernhollow feature push to limit exposure, and marketing is holding the relaunch. Settlement talks resume next month. Our preferred path forward is outlined in the note below.

board note of yajeg-yaweg: The pricing group signed off on a budget of $4.9 million for Project Quenix. The renewal with Sormirek Freight closes at $6.1 million a year, 37 percent below the last contract.